Sussex fashion fans can cash in on top designer clothing at discount prices at an event planned for the end of the month.
Hove-based Frances Conway has spent more than two decades working in the fashion industry. She ran Names Designer Discounts in The Lanes, Brighton, from the Eighties until it closed last May.
For her latest venture, Frances has booked a suite at the Thistle Hotel which she intends to stock with items from names such as Jasper Conran, Dolce and Gabbana and Valentino.
Frances said: "I was the first person in the UK to offer designer products at discount rates. I got the idea while on a trip to America where the practice was already established and I introduced it back over here very successfully.
"The idea of setting up a shop in a hotel is new for this business as well. There are plenty of fashion shows or discount events, which can turn into a bit of a bun fight.
This is different. It is an opportunity to see the clothes displayed in a good but temporary environment."
The event will showcase summer wear and includes cashmere from Scotland and a suede collection.
Frances said: "We tried to hold a similar event before Christmas for the winter wardrobe but it was the day the hurricane hit and the trains were not working which was bad for business.
"Those who braved the weather said it was marvellous and well worth the effort. We are expecting a big turnout this time."
